What Is Shopify?

Shopify

Shopify is a cloud-based solution that helps you create a personalized online store and handle daily operations. It provides you with a range of tools for handling payments, marketing and product management. You can also use it to sell your products in multiple locations, including offline sales. There is even a feature that allows you to build an entirely customized experience for B2B and DTC customers.

The company has an extensive app library. In addition to apps that help you do things like automate checkout, manage shipping and handle marketing, there are also apps that will provide you with insights on your customers. Some of these include Shopify’s own POS app and QR code generator. They also have a free SSL certificate available for all users. Regardless of whether you sell online or in person, you can use Shopify’s intuitive dashboard to manage your inventory and track your revenues.

To get started, you’ll need a unique store name. Luckily, the platform is flexible enough to let you use your existing domain, or purchase a new one from the platform. Once you’ve decided on a name, you can add your products, set up a payment processor, and customize the look of your site.
